FAC UL TY GLENN U. PHILLIPS Mr. Glenn U. Phillips has been with McDonald High School as head oi the Musrc Department since 1938. Mr. Phil- lips is a graduate of Dana Music lnstitute, Warren, Ohio, and of Kent State University and Westminster Col- lege He received his Bachelor of Music and Science in 1939 and his M.S. in Education in 1252. Mr. Phillips con- ducts the grade school orchestra as well as the high school band and or- chestra. WILMA MEEK Mrs. Wilma Meek received her B.S. degree in Home Economics from the University of Wisconsin in 1924, where she was a member of Phi Upsilon Omi- cron Sorority and the Professional Home Economics Sorority. Mrs. Meek is the Head of the Home Economics Department at McDonald High School. PARENT-TEACHERS ASSOCIATION We may refer to the P.T.A. as the cushion that makes the riding more comfortable. Our hats are off to our local school supporters who have cushioned our work by presenting our school with equipment necessary to make a child's school life more interesting. At Christmas time our buildings beam with the Christmas trees pre- sented, on the playground, activities and games are carried on through the efforts of thoughtful P.T.A. people: wet clothing is no longer a problem at Roosevelt School since the installation of the clothes dryer: now for the benefit of all students, an audiometer has been presented in order that the hearing acuity of each student may be checked. This screening program is being carried on by Mrs. Lindsey and Mr. Kukuk. Financial support for this program comes through membership dues and the annual school fair. We of McDonald Schools say -- Good work P.T.A. : we greatly appreciate your interest. PAGE E
